General Conditions for Concentrating Trace Organic Compounds in Water with Porous Polystyrene Cartridges

Abstract
General application conditions of the solid phase extraction with porous polystyrene polymer cartridges, Sep-Pak PS-1 and PS-2, were investigated.
The PS-1 and PS-2 could adsorb various organic compounds from water in several ten times to several hundred times in comparison with tC18 which is a conventional octadecylsilane adsorbent. The adsorbable volumes for the solution to PS-2 are more than ca. 70% of those to PS-1. The adsorbable volumes for single component solution of 44 compounds to the PS-1 cartridge could be shown by the function of the concentration C and the solubility in water S. The adsorbed compounds could desorb with 3ml acetone from PS-1 and PS-2. From these results, the procedure for deciding the concentration conditions for simultaneous analysis or bioassay test of various trace organic compounds in water samples was proposed. It was confirmed that various trace compounds in the river water samples could be concentrated simultaneously by the proposed conditions.
